Practical Publisher Notes for Implementation

Before deploying any new design assets, I always run through a checklist to ensure optimal performance and legal safety. Here are my recommendations for using Quirky Christmas Dog Caroler Clipart effectively:

  1. Test Across Devices: Preview the graphics on both desktop and mobile screens. Ensure the details remain clear on smaller displays and that the file size does not slow down page load times.
  2. Check Contrast and Readability: Place the illustrations against various background colors. Test them with serif font, sans serif font, and script font styles to see which combination offers the best readability and aesthetic harmony.
  3. Optimize File Size: Even high-quality illustrations need to be compressed for web performance. Use tools to reduce file size without losing clarity to maintain fast loading speeds, which is a key factor in SEO.
  4. Verify Licensing: Always confirm the commercial license terms before using these assets on monetized websites, affiliate pages, or in paid digital products. Ensuring you have the right to use the graphic design asset commercially protects your business from legal issues.
  5. Experiment with Layouts: Try placing the illustrations beside different typography styles. A handwritten font might enhance the quirky vibe, while a bold display font could create a striking modern contrast.
